Background technology
Membrane pressure filter in unit are disposal ability, reduce filter cake moisture, all show significant effect in the adaptability of the character of material handling etc.Diaphragm filter press is compared general filter and is had more advantage: each block filter plate is combined into by one block of compoboard and one piece of polypropylene filter plate, and compoboard is made up of two panels filter frame, be equivalent to have two filter clothes to filter the same simultaneously, not only facilitate replacing filter cloth, also make efficiency be multiplied; Diaphragm filter press filter board generally adopts glass fiber reinforced polypropylene, and film adopts natural rubber, and such equipment use is stablized, and be full of cracks experiment reaches 100,000 times; Diaphragm filter press equipment have employed the design of automatic washing filter cloth, has saved water, has also saved the time, in addition, additionally uses automatic discharging design, a people substantially can be had to control, reduce the cost of use.Although existing diaphragm filter press has more advantage, still there is some shortcomings part; Existing diaphragm filter press is in the process used; in the mixing be extruded; flow out together with solution owing to there being quite a lot of tiny impurity; often there is the phenomenon extruded in impurity; therefore the pipelined channel formed on filter side often can be blocked; cause the solution be extruded to flow into out smoothly, have impact on the operating efficiency of filter to a certain extent, improve the cost of use.
For above-mentioned technical problem, application number is the filter of a kind of membrane pressure filter of Chinese patent of 201420009881.9, it is arranged in frame, comprise body, the through hole for sepage is provided with in the middle of body, body both sides are equipped with groove, several equally distributed projections are provided with in described groove, several equally distributed boss are also provided with in groove, this boss flushes with body surface, this boss can ensure the space between groove floor and filter membrane, impurity is avoided to extrude blocking loss passage, improve production efficiency, but in actual use, this filter uses with filter press is supporting, be subject to the squeezing action of filter press, mutual impact and extruding force can be produced between adjacent filter, mutual extruding force can be there is in the boss be meanwhile distributed in the groove of adjacent head plate, and conventional boss material can select the glass fiber reinforced polypropylene consistent with bulk material to make, after using for a long time, comparatively serious wearing and tearing can be produced, particularly boss is away from one end place of groove, once there are wearing and tearing in this place, its effect just can be had a greatly reduced quality.

The primary structure of the crashproof filter of membrane pressure filter comprises plate body 1, plate body 1 is provided with the through hole 2 for sepage, plate body 1 both sides are equipped with groove 3, lug boss 4 is provided with in groove 3, lug boss 4 comprises main boss 41, secondary boss 42, the hardness of main boss 41 is greater than the hardness of plate body 1, secondary boss 42 is provided with through hole 5, main boss 41 is positioned at through hole 5, main boss 41 flushes with plate body 1 surface, the height of secondary boss 42 is lower than the height of plate body 1, lug boss 4 is divided into main boss 41 and secondary boss 42, main boss 41 is positioned at through hole 5, main boss 41 flushes with plate body 1 surface, when adjacent filter be subject to filter press squeezing action and occur mutually against time, now main boss 41 not only serves the space ensured between groove 3 bottom surface and filter membrane, impurity is avoided to extrude blocking loss passage, and directly squeezing action can be there is with the main boss 41 be positioned on adjacent plate body 1 in main boss 41, and the hardness of main boss 41 is greater than the hardness of plate body 1, even if through long-time squeezing action, main boss 41 also can have longer service life compared to traditional boss, secondary boss 42 arranges through hole 5, and main boss 41 is positioned at through hole 5, now secondary boss 42 just serves the effect supporting main boss 41, when main boss 41 occurs to extrude with the main boss 41 be positioned on adjacent plate body 1, there will be the tilting force of side direction unavoidably, secondary boss 42 then can provide enough support forces, prevents main boss 41 from toppling over, prevents the problem that one-sided wearing and tearing appear in main boss 41.
Some projections 6 are also provided with in groove 3, the height of projection 6 is lower than the height of boss, elongated along with service time, filter membrane there will be slack and undisciplined phenomenon unavoidably, and now filter membrane will against groove 3 cell wall, and projection 6 just can avoid above-mentioned situation to occur, the runner for filtrate flows can be there is between some projections, in filter process, can ensure that filtrate can long-time stable outwards be oozed out constantly, promote filter effect.
Lug boss 4 be provided with 4 and circle distribution in through hole 2 surrounding, the contact area between the main boss 41 of adjacent head plate can be increased, reduce concentrate on extruding force on single lug boss 4, reduce the wearing and tearing on main boss 41.
The shape of main boss 41 is cylindrical, and the shape of secondary boss 42 is truncated cone-shaped, and the large end of secondary boss 42 is fixed on bottom groove 3, said structure, first, when filter membrane and lug boss 4 occur to conflict, can not because of extruding force, and occur damaged; Secondly, the small end of secondary boss 42 flushes with main boss 41 one end away from groove 3, amplitude peak can promote the support force of secondary boss 42 for main boss 41, promote the stability in use of lug boss 4.
Due to plate body 1 be generally adopt be glass fiber reinforced polypropylene material, main boss 41 is made up of stainless steel, adopt the main boss 41 that stainless steel is made, first, stainless steel wants high compared to glass fiber reinforced polypropylene hardness, in the process of extruding mutually, more wearing and tearing can be resisted; Secondly, because this filter is generally used for the filter progress of bromamine acid solution, main boss 41 often can contact bromamine acid solution, and just can containing a large amount of moisture content in this solution, stainless steel mass-energy ensures still to keep non-corrosive after contacting a large amount of moisture content, promotes the service life of this main boss 41.
The both sides of plate body 1 are equipped with bracing frame 7, bracing frame 7 is provided with cylinder 8, traditional filter is only that frame is on the supporting walls of filter press, when filter press is in pressure-filtering process, mode in sliding friction between whole filter and supporting walls moves, and now on bracing frame 7, arranges cylinder 8, and can change traditional sliding friction is rolling friction, decrease both coefficient of frictions, improve the service life of filter.
